Last night began like any other Wednesday evening. Bumper to bumper commute, the quick errand squeezed in and the rush home to catch the first pitch. The extra half hour afforded me by the kind folks at Turner Stadium allows me to sink into the couch with dinner in hand. I turn on the set and hear the familiar voices of Rem and Orsillo before the picture comes into view. The TV is right where I left it on Tuesday night, tuned to NESN...

As I get settled in and take my first bite of food, I'm stunned by the early crack of that bat with JD Drew's lead-off homer. "This isn't going to be an ordinary night, is it?",  I rhetorically ask myself. Five runs later the top of the first mercifully comes to an end for Atlanta. Not a bad way for Tavarez to make his start being spotted such a lead before throwing a pitch. A one, two, three bottom of the inning and then the Sox are back at it. Lugo goes down for the first out and Drew steps to the plate for the second time in as many innings. He hits it hard again, and just then something happens. He injures himself legging out the double. JD goes on to score, the inning ends with the Sox picking up another two, but Wily Mo has now replaced him in Right field! Just then the phone rings. It's Karen, my girlfriend, calling from her son's Little League game. She says "Let me set the stage for you... it's 2 outs, bases loaded, bottom of the 6th, score tied 6 - 6... guess who steps to the plate?" I know she is referring to her son Brandon, who can be a little devil at times, so seeing the opportunity, I come back with "let me guess... DAMIAN?" "that's right!" she exclaims, "and he got the game winning hit!"

* a side note - Karen was born on October 31st, and "Damian" AKA Brandon,  her son was born the morning after Halloween, 29 years later. *

At the same time Drew is hurting himself, to be replaced by Wily Mo, Brandon hits the game winning hit in his Little League playoff game. Is this coincedence or some strange omen? I suggest BOTH.

 Brandon has Wily Mo Pena listed as his favorite player on his Little League baseball card. I can't wait to see what the little devil does next!
